- - - The Tennessee Titans sent some of their big guns to the respective pro days of Penn State and the University of Cincinnati on Thursday. - According to NFL Network’s Mike Giardi, general manager Jon Robinson was in attendance at the Penn State event. There were a slew of intriguing prospects taking part, including wide receiver Jahan Dotson. - Titans head coach Mike Vrabel, quarterbacks coach Pat O’Hara and defensive backs coach Anthony Midget were in attendance at the Cincinnati Pro Day, according to Senior Bowl executive director, Jim Nagy. - While Vrabel and Midget will be taking a look at a number of prospects, the presence of O’Hara means the Titans are specifically looking at Bearcats quarterback, Desmond Ridder. - - Titans coach Mike Vrabel checking out the #Bearcats practice before UC’s Pro Day begins.Fun fact: Luke Fickell was the best man at his wedding pic.twitter.com/hPtvERVXkR - — Dan Hoard (@Dan_Hoard) March 24, 2022 - - - Ridder is one of the players the Titans met with at the 2022 NFL Combine and he remains a possibility for Tennessee in the upcoming draft.
